Eureka spikers beat Whitefish in three games

WHITEFISH — The Eureka Lions bounced the Whitefish Bulldogs in three games in non-conference volleyball Tuesday.

“We struggled to put consistent points together and serve consistently,” Whitefish coach Addy Connelly said. ”They hit well which really pulled us out of system and we struggled to find our rhythm.”

Rhianna Hawkins led Eureka with 11 blocks and Kamber Brown had 28 assists and two service aces.

Whitefish’s Ashton Ramsey had 11 digs and Mikenna Ells checked in with nine assists.

Eureka had 34 kills to Whitefish’s 12.

Eureka def. Whitefish 25-18, 25-19, 25-18

Kills — Eureka 34, Whitefish 12 (Brook Smith 2, Brooke Zetooney 3, Jadi Walburn 1); Assists — Eureka 28 (Kamber Brown), Whitefish 12 (Mikenna Ells 9, Jenny Patten 2, Gabby Herrick 1); Blocks — Eureka 28 (Rhianna Hawkins 11), Whitefish 7 (Zetooney 2, Smith 2, Ells 2, Emma Trieweiler 1), Aces — Eureka 4 (Brown 2), Whitefish 2 (Trieweiler 1, Smith 1); Digs — Eureka 10 (Michael Shea 5), Whitefish 50 (Ashton Ramsey 11, Trieweiler 8, Ells 8, Smith 8, Patten 6).
